What are Family Safaris?
Family safaris is a special kind of tour that is designed for families with children during which families can not only observe the wildlife but can also learn a lot enjoying the process. These safaris are usually represented by qualified leaders who know everything about handling children and creating an interesting atmosphere for everyone.
Main Differences between Family Safaris and Regular Safaris
1. Age-Appropriate Activities
Family safaris represent a number of exercises that are made for people of any age starting from five or six years old children till teenagers. These activities may include:
Guided nature walks: Relatively brief and non-strenuous walks that give the children a chance to actually go about their environment and discover aspects of nature that they may have never encountered otherwise.

Wildlife spotting: There are organized game drives or game walks where the main purpose is to complete sighting of particular species, the famous big five lion, leopard, rhino, elephant and buffalo.
Conservation education: Practical lessons where kids are educated on how they can participate in the matter concerning conservation of environment.

2. Accommodation and Amenities
Family safaris typically offer accommodations that are designed with families in mind, such as:
Family-friendly lodges: Accommodation facilities that have large rooms or suites for family- sized groups and other for a family such as kids’ club, game room, pool etc.
Camping options: Camping facilities that are enjoyable for children and which offers activities such as campfire, outdoors games and storytelling sessions.
In the case of normal Safaris, they may have low end accommodation or do a lodge based Safari targeting adults.
3. Safety and Supervision
Family safaris prioritize the safety and supervision of children, with:
Experienced guides: Qualified care givers who have undergone through guides training for children with special needs for required care and play.
Child-friendly vehicles: Cars that are fitted with safety belts, car seats and other options that give a assurance a safe viewing of the game.

First-aid kits and emergency procedures: Some guides and lodges which can accommodate medical emergencies and also the measures in place to ensure all family members are kept safe.
Ordinary game drives might not be as controlled or safe as may seem because the customers are presumed to be mature enough to handle whatever comes their way.
4. Flexibility and Customization
Family safaris are often more flexible and customizable than regular safaris, with:
Personalized itineraries: Flexible itineraries that can accommodate every individual’s need and things that they would love to do with the family.
Flexible schedules: Flexible timings that would include children’s needs such as nap time or even break for meal.
Activity options: A flexible spectrum of the kind of activities, which may be game drives, walks or cultural visits that can be chosen according to interests and /or age.
Scheduled or normal tours, may mean having a stricter regimen in terms of type of game, timing and frequency, as well as the degree to which the tourists’ needs and wants may be met.
